Primetime TV Ratings - Week 16

Written by TVSA Team from the blog Primetime TV Viewing Figures on 24 Apr 2015
Favourite this post


These are the primetime adult television viewing figures for 13 - 19 April, 2015.

Top Shows By Genre

Top Dramas

1) Tempy Pushas (SABC1) 4,246,000
2) Mopheme (SABC2) 2,337,000
3) Thokolosi (SABC2) 1,448,000
4) Umlilo (e.tv) 1,020,000
5) Matatiele (e.tv) 790,000

Top Reality Shows

1) Nyan' Nyan (SABC1) 2,304,000
2) The Perfect Sishebo Show (SABC1) 2,140,000
3) Mokapelo (SABC1) 1,679,000
4) Holiday Swap (SABC1) 1,448,000
5) Khumbul'ekhaya (SABC1) 1,448,000

Top Comedies

1) Thandeka's Diary (SABC1) 2,864,000
2) iThuba Lokugcina (SABC1) 2,699,000
3) Modern Family (e.tv) 2,041,000
4) Moferefere Lenyalong (R) (SABC2) 2,041,000
5) Ga Re Dumele (SABC2) 1,448,000

Top News Bulletins

1) Zulu News (SABC1) 3,144,000
2) Xhosa News (SABC1) 2,986,000
3) Siswati/Ndebele News (SABC1) 1,159,000
4) Sesotho/Tswana/Sepedi News (SABC2) 892,000
5) eNews Prime Time (e.tv) 813,000

Top Soap Operas

1) Generations (SABC1) 5,320,000
2) uZalo (SABC1) 4,651,000
3) Skeem Saam (SABC1) 4,530,000
4) Muvhango (SABC2) 4,187,000
5) Scandal! (e.tv) 2,890,000

Top Talk Shows

1) Motswako (SABC2) 593,000
2) Steve Harvey (SABC1) 527,000
3) The Talk (SABC1) 487,000
4) Steve Harvey (e.tv) 441,000
5) 3 Talk (SABC3) 402,000

Top Actuality Shows

1) Speak Out (SABC2) 1,876,000
2) Sunday Live (SABC1) 1,778,000
3) Cutting Edge (SABC1) 1,020,000
4) Checkpoint (e.tv) 955,000
5) Leihlo La Sechaba (SABC2) 593,000

Top Magazine Shows

1) Inside Access (SABC1) 2,140,000
2) The Real Goboza (SABC1) 1,975,000
3) Top Billing (SABC3) 625,000
4) Nhlalala Ya Rixaka (SABC2) 593,000
5) Pasella (SABC2) 560,000

Top Game Shows

1) Friends Like These (SABC1) 2,107,000
2) I Love South Africa (e.tv) 790,000
3) Noot vir Noot (SABC2) 625,000

Top Documentaries

1) Come Again (SABC1) 1,646,000
2) I Shouldn't Be Alive (e.tv) 1,613,000
3) Come Again (R) (SABC1) 757,000
4) Docuville (SABC3) 296,000
5) Ba Kae? (SABC2) 280,000

Top Primetime Movies

1) Babylon A.D. (e.tv) 1,745,000
2) Meet the Parents (e.tv) 1,317,000
3) Yours, Mine & Ours (SABC2) 1,119,000
4) Cruel Intentions (e.tv) 823,000
5) The Cutting Edge: Going for the Gold (SABC3) 790,000

Top 10 Regular Shows (excluding News bulletins)

1) Generations (SABC1) 5,320,000
2) uZalo (SABC1) 4,651,000
3) Skeem Saam (SABC1) 4,530,000
4) Tempy Pushas (SABC1) 4,246,000
5) Muvhango (SABC2) 4,187,000
6) Scandal! (e.tv) 2,890,000
7) Thandeka's Diary (SABC1) 2,864,000
8) iThuba Lokugcina (SABC1) 2,699,000
9) Mopheme (SABC2) 2,337,000
10) Nyan' Nyan (SABC1) 2,304,000

Please note: the numbers for various shows are down this week due to the daily loadshedding that occurred.
